Summary

Mohammad Sikder is a Labour Migration Specialist with more than 20 years empirical research, 10 years teaching and 8 years consultancy experience as a Monitoring, Evaluation, Research and Learning Expert with ILO, IOM, UNHCR, DFID/FCDO, British Council, European Commission, GIZ, USAID and Swiss Agency for Development and Cooperation (SDC). Sikder''s research expertise includes internal and international labour migration; modern slavery and labour migration recruitment (OLR) process; returnee migrants' reintegration; remittances, development, dependency and inequality; Migration and TVET Skills for Employment; forced migration and Rohingya (Myanmar) refugees’ situation; irregular cross-border migration, human smuggling and trafficking; Ready-Made Garments (RMG), Trade Unions and Women Empowerment; and climate change-induced migration, urban resettlement and livelihood. Sikder has extensively written on migration issues and published several books, book chapters and articles in national and international reputed publications.
